The Best Eating Regimen for People with Osteoarthritis

The Best Eating Regimen for People with Osteoarthritis

 

Author: Michael Byrd

The finest health plan for someone with osteoarthritis is a full eating regimen. But, if this sounds too simple, let\'s look into it a little closer.

In essence, \"whole food\" should never be equated to processed food. Processed food does not have nutritional value anymore because processing strips off its nutrients, leaving natural food useless.

For example, when grains or fatty acids are made into flour or pasta, fatty acids are removed - not because they should really not be there but because they aid rotting.

Food spoilage will result in shorter shelf life, which in turn will cost the manufacturer more. Hence, it is best that fatty acids are removed from bread.

Now you can easily understand why it is important to eat foods close to its natural state to make sure you are getting the right nutrients for your body.

So, now that you are ready to eat whole foods, the next question is: Which foods you should take to manage osteoarthritis? That is a good question.

Aside from devoting yourself to eat a balanced diet consisting of vegetables, whole grains, lean meat, dairy, and fresh fruit, you should concentrate on foods that improve collagen, inhibit inflammation, and promote strong bones and cartilage.

Among the different foods included in the anti-inflammatory group, oily fish is considered the primary source. So it is best that you consume two to five servings in a week and additional fish oil consumption everyday to help you overcome chronic inflammation.

Secondary to oily fish in the anti-inflammatory group are red and black grapes, blueberries, citrus, beets, and garlic.

Citrus foods can help improve collagen. Collagen is known to provide more rigidity and elasticity to the tissues.

Solid amounts of collagen are needed for stronger bones including calcium from eggshells and dairy and amino acids from good sources of protein.

Lastly, you need glucosamine to maintain your body\'s capacity to repair any damage in your bones and maintain your joint cartilage in one piece. You can get it from shellfish with its shell. This is the best source of glucosamine among other sources.

Of course, it\'s not easy staying healthy and eating healthy but you really have to if you want to avoid health problems like osteoarthritis. And if you really want to solve this problem, you really should maintain a diet with natural food based supplements.

To help you prevent and relieve symptoms of osteoarthritis, you need to consume more glucosamine hydrochloride and omega 3 fatty acids. The first can be found in shrimp and lobsters while the second supplement can be found in fishes. Glucosamine hydrochloride is known to protect your cartilage while omega 3 fatty acids are known to relieve inflammation.

These two act together to generate remarkable results. And getting glucosamine supplement is less complicated than getting it from shrimps and lobsters.

For women, it is best that you take calcium and vitamin C complex. These things are important supplements to promote healthy bones and healthy collagen.

Now, it is clear that the only best source of solution for people with osteoarthritis is whole foods. So any form of processed foods must be thrown away.
